Lecture #16: ritual as sacred action, zunzi. He who tries to enter it with the uncouth and inane. Special context involving what participants take to be sacred: akitu festival. Seasonal ritual to secure the continuance of the seasonal cycle. First 4 days are somber: express powerless and desolation of the king, prayers at the temples, chaos and death --> order and new life. 6-8th day: priests and people acted out over victory of marduk. 9th day: triumph of precession of the king, new year"s feast. 10th day: feast held for kings gods priests, return of fertility to the land, marriage between female temple slave and king. Ritual: cosmic and political level, cosmically the fertility of the new year is ensued, politically the king"s authority is renewed. Festival: renews the city, renews the king, renews the people. Gaster: akitu is founded on the enuma elish, myths and rituals are always connected, humiliation and restoration = death and resurrection.
